Cruise Overview

The Overview is a preparatory document from the Chief Scientists to the vessel. It is submitted to the Field Operations Leaders and the FOCI Liaison Officer in December for spring cruises and in May for summer and fall cruises. If draft Cruise Instructions have already been submitted, then the Overview is not required. The Overview is a few pages that briefly address the following:

Include draft itinerary, area of operations, type of operations, special equipment requirements. This information is presented to the ship and publicly discussed at the Pre-Season briefing meeting (MILLER FREEMAN.)
